Buspak: Nest
Crossing paths with the best for 60 years of achievement in China.
Buspak – Hong Kong’s leading bus advertising agency – proudly celebrates National Day.
Advertising Agency: JWT Hong Kong
Creative Directors: Ming Chan
Art Directors: Ming Chan, Thomas Chung, Bobby Chan
Copywriters: Steven Lee
Illustrator: Anton
Print Production: Jimmy Pong
Client Service: Dennis Lam, Claudia Tsang
Published: September 2009
